Jose J. Ferrer, Jr. challenged the constitutionality of two Quezon City ordinances imposing a Socialized Housing Tax and an annual garbage fee, arguing they were illegal taxes for services that should be funded by general revenues. The Quezon City government defended the ordinances as valid exercises of its taxing authority. The Supreme Court issued a temporary restraining order and ruled that Ferrer had legal standing to challenge the ordinances, despite procedural objections from the respondents.
